What's The Definition Of Provoking?
[adj] causing or tending to cause anger or resentment; "a provoking delay at the airport"
Synonyms | Synonyms for Provoking: agitating | agitative | provocative Related Terms | Find terms related to Provoking: See Also | Provoking In Webster's Dictionary \Pro*vok"ing\, a.
Having the power or quality of exciting resentment; tending
to awaken passion or vexation; as, provoking words or
treatment. -- {Pro*vok"ing*ly}, adv.
